LCx was compared to other assays in measuring human immunodeficiency virus type 1 (HIV-1) CRF02 viremia. LCx showed significant but low correlation with the other methods. Values of <2.60 log(10) cp/ml were observed in 29.6% of specimens with LCx and in only 14.8% with bDNA and PCR, suggesting suboptimal performance of LCx with CRF02. 相似文献
Prevalence rates of mental health disorders in children and adolescents have increased two to threefold from the 1990s to 2016. Some increase in prevalence may stem from changing environmental conditions in the current generation which interact with genes and inherited genetic variants. Current measured genetic variant effects do not explain fully the familial clustering and high heritability estimates in the population. Another model considers environmental conditions shifting in the previous generation, which altered brain circuits epigenetically and were transmitted to offspring via non-DNA-based mechanisms (intergenerational and transgenerational effects). Parental substance use, poor diet and obesity are environmental factors with known epigenetic intergenerational and transgenerational effects, that regulate set points in brain pathways integrating sensory-motor, reward and feeding behaviors. Using summary statistics for eleven neuropsychiatric and three metabolic disorders from 128,989 families, an epigenetic effect explains more of the estimated heritability when a portion of parental environmental effects are transmitted to offspring alongside additive genetic variance.Subject terms: Genetic variation, ADHD, Addiction, Autism spectrum disorders, Genetic variation相似文献
Summary: Chemical shift trends in the methylene and α substituent regions of 13C NMR spectra of vinyl polymers have been analyzed in terms of a three‐state rotational isomeric states (RIS) model and the γ‐gauche effect. In this framework, it has been demonstrated that the three sequencing rules observed for poly(propylene) can also be expected to work for many other vinyl polymers. The first two rules, justified in terms of the conformational perturbability of stereosequences, turn out to be respected by a considerable number of NMR spectra. On the other hand, the same spectral data are in substantial disagreement with the third rule. An explanation is proposed for this breakdown.

The t(2;5)(p23;q35) translocation associated with CD30-positive anaplastic large cell lymphoma results in the production of a NPM-ALK chimeric protein, consisting of the N-terminal portion of the NPM protein joined to the entire cytoplasmic domain of the neural receptor tyrosine kinase ALK. The ALK gene products were identified in paraffin sections by using a new anti-ALK (cytoplasmic portion) monoclonal antibody (ALKc) that tends to react more strongly than a previously described ALK1 antibody with the nuclei of ALK-expressing tumor cells after microwave heating in 1 mmol/L ethylenediaminetetraacetic acid buffer, pH 8.0. The ALKc monoclonal antibody reacted selectively with 60% of anaplastic large cell lymphoma cases (60 of 100), which occurred mainly in the first three decades of life and consistently displayed a T/null phenotype. This group of ALK-positive tumors showed a wide morphological spectrum including cases with features of anaplastic large cell lymphoma “common” type (75%), “lymphohistiocytic” (10%), “small cell” (8.3%), “giant cell” (3.3%), and “Hodgkin’s like” (3.3%). CD30-positive large anaplastic cells expressing the ALK protein both in the cytoplasm and nucleus represented the dominant tumor population in the common, Hodgkin’s-like and giant cell types, but they were present at a smaller percentage (often with a perivascular distribution) also in cases with lymphohistiocytic and small cell features. In this study, the ALKc antibody also allowed us to identify small neoplastic cells (usually CD30 negative) with nucleus-restricted ALK positivity that were, by definition, more evident in the small cell variant but were also found in cases with lymphohistiocytic, common, and “Hodgkin’s-like” features. These findings, which have not been previously emphasized, strongly suggest that the neoplastic lesion (the NPM-ALK gene) must be present both in the large anaplastic and small tumor cells, and that ALK-positive lymphomas lie on a spectrum, their position being defined by the ratio of small to large neoplastic cells. Notably, about 15% of all ALK-positive lymphomas (usually of the common or giant cell variant) showed a cytoplasm-restricted ALK positivity, which suggests that the ALK gene may have fused with a partner(s) other than NPM. From a diagnostic point of view, detection of the ALK protein was useful in distinguishing anaplastic large cell lymphoma cases of lymphohistiocytic and small cell variants from reactive conditions and other peripheral T-cell lymphoma subtypes, as well as for detecting a small number of tumor cells in lymphohemopoietic tissues. In conclusion, ALK positivity appears to define a clinicopathological entity with a T/null phenotype (“ALK lymphomas”), but one that shows a wider spectrum of morphological patterns than has been appreciated in the past. 相似文献
Previous literature presents discordant results on the relationship between physiological and subjective sexual arousal in women. In this study, the use of hierarchical linear modeling (HLM) revealed a significant concordance between continuous measures of physiological and subjective sexual arousal as assessed during exposure to erotic stimuli in a laboratory setting. We propose that past studies that have found little or no association between the two measures may have been in part limited by the methodology and statistical analyses employed. 相似文献
